Yemeni Missile and Drone Attacks Target Saudi Aramco Facilities in Jizan
First report 5h agoLast update 1h agoReports confirm Yemeni missile and drone attacks on Jizan, resulting in fires, smoke plumes, and damage to Aramco facilities.
Some sources frame the Yemeni attacks as retaliation for Saudi Arabia's siege on Yemen and strikes on the Port of Hodeidah.
Saudi Arabia condemns the 'unprovoked' attacks and issues emergency alerts, while also reportedly striking Sanaa Airport in Yemen in retaliation.
